Canada’s THE WRING Releases Powerful Proggy New Single “The Sword”

The Wring - Album Lineup - L-R - Kyle Brian Abbott - Drums, Don Dewulf – Guitars, Reggie Hache – Bass, Vocals & Keyboards

New Album “Nemesis” Out Sept 27th, 2024 via WormHoleDeath Records

Sudbury, Canada’s intrepid prog act The Wring is thrilled to announce the release of their latest single “The Sword” from their upcoming album “Nemesis” slated for a September 27, 2024 release on WormHoleDeath Records. This track exemplifies the band’s signature blend of heavy rock with progressive elements, showcasing their ability to craft intricate compositions that resonate with both metalheads and prog enthusiasts alike. “The Sword” is an intense sonic journey that combines relentless guitar riffs with dynamic shifts in tempo, as commented on by guitarist Don Dewulf:

“I’ve had the main riff and structure for a long time, but it never felt right. I tried it with other drummers and bass players and always put it to the side. I came back to it again for Nemesis. With Reggie’s vocals and bass and Kyle’s drumming, suddenly it felt great. Almost Megadeth-y. Super fun to play. I actually used a Dave Mustaine signature King V to play it because I was getting too much spring noise from my Floyd guitars while picking the fast parts. Reggie used a pick (which he rarely does) for an extra attack. The bass lines are killer. Probably the most ‘metal’ song I’ve recorded.”

“The Sword” is more than just a heavy track; it’s a narrative-driven piece that explores themes of conflict and confrontation. Dewulf’s powerful riffs set the stage for a musical battle, while Reggie Hache’s bass and vocal work add depth and intensity to the song’s atmosphere.

This single is a taste of what’s to come on The Wring’s fourth album. The music is juxtaposed, with hard rock and metal mixed with jazz and prog elements.
